Damage-Free Leak Testing

Non-destructive leak detection methods offer a critical advantage in various sectors, allowing engineers and specialists to pinpoint breaches without disrupting processes or causing harm to the machinery. Unlike destructive methods, these techniques employ advanced techniques such as helium mass spectrometry, pressure decay analysis, or tracer gas identification to precisely locate and quantify leakage from pipes, vessels, read more and other enclosed assemblies. This proactive strategy minimizes downtime, prevents costly remedies, and ensures reliability by identifying potential issues before they escalate into more serious failures. Furthermore, ongoing monitoring with NDT leak testing supports preventative preservation programs, optimizing efficiency and extending the longevity of critical assets.

Identifying Buried Leak Surveys

Detecting obscured gas leaks can be a difficult process, often requiring specialized equipment and expertise. Subsurface leak surveys, also known as pipe leak detection, utilize a variety of non-destructive techniques, including acoustic listening, ground penetrating imaging, and corrosion testing, to pinpoint the exact source of the concern. These investigations are vital for preventing further deterioration to infrastructure and minimizing charges. Ultimately, a comprehensive subsurface leak survey provides a dependable diagnosis and allows for precise repairs, ensuring the continued integrity of buried pipes.
